Transaction 50891c628138d71ce70f3be9d9901cc7c7f28304eb70d45f0177115fe772dd43

1 Input
2 Outputs
  • 50891c628138d71ce70f3be9d9901cc7c7f28304eb70d45f0177115fe772dd43:0
  • value  952210766
    address  1HYDfkp6TReDcMD9ig8SbHj7sBBk8fCYmA
  • 50891c628138d71ce70f3be9d9901cc7c7f28304eb70d45f0177115fe772dd43:1
  • value  40632933
    address  13iRT2QY2U7a5qNWBDGfqVcWTSHnbyjfhh